I have a macbook pro with 256gb of storage. I have a 150gb music library and another 100gb of photos and videos. I currently have a Seagate Central 3TB to backup this stuff but when I want to listen to itunes and use photos on the macbook, its sooooo slow, plus the seagate just broke.

what would be my best option to be able to backup all of my stuff but also be able to access it often? I'd like to be able to listen to my music library through iTunes but not have to store the music on the computer, and also have speed with no lag.

Is the lag you experience momentary at the beginning of accessing data? A lot of external type drives will spin down after a few minutes.

If you'd rather have centralized storage at home then you'd either be looking at a NAS appliance (such as Synology) or building your own file server type of computer.

Is there a budget you had in mind? How much capacity would you be shooting for?
